Transaction 801393957a61765c9c6db03b6b8f5133574680d65df7bab949e3a9797cf07643
1 Input
1 Output
-
801393957a61765c9c6db03b6b8f5133574680d65df7bab949e3a9797cf07643:0
- value
- 44997337
- script pubkey
- OP_0 OP_PUSHBYTES_20 aed90fb796ae11a4a745e34152e798f0c0b1d12b
- address
- bc1q4mvslduk4cg6ff69udq49euc7rqtr5ftvfxuzl